Hyundai Patent Shows Cell-Phone Disabling Technology

Hyundai Driver Cell Phone Blocking Patent

Can't put down the smartphone while driving? Hyundai has a patent for technology that can render it as dumb as a Motorola DynaTAC.

Autoblog reports the patent shows technology that "limits or disables the use of some of mobile device features which could cause distraction to the user." The system determines when and what to disable on a phone based on vehicle speed, time of day, importance of message, and other factors, and can do so either at the driver's seat or the entire vehicle.

According to the patent, this is done with cellular-signal-monitoring antennas placed throughout the cabin. When an antenna detects a signal, the system performs the tasks needed to disable functions that would otherwise hinder a driver's ability to maintain vigilance. However, the system requires the phone in question to have firmware that would accept the former's commands.
